5.6 Additive Inverse :
The additive inverse of 5.6 is -5.6.
This means that when we add 5.6 and -5.6, the result is zero:
5.6 + (-5.6) = 0
Additive Inverse of a Decimal Number
For decimal numbers, we simply change the sign of the number:
- Original number: 5.6
- Additive inverse: -5.6
To verify: 5.6 + (-5.6) = 0
